You can even check with the documentation, which is extremely beneficial each time you’re in any sort of confusion. As Quickly As you unzip the archive file, you’ll see a lot of files and folders that aren’t required for our tutorial. Bounce instantly into the dist listing and copy all of the folders to a new destination, which shall be your project home.

what does bootstrap do

The most recent version of the framework, Bootstrap four, has a selection of enhancements and new capabilities over Bootstrap three. They comprise further CSS variables, an enhanced typography system, and a brand new grid system with more breakpoints. All the blocks and bits of code used in Bootstrap are fastidiously defined.

How To Begin Studying Bootstrap

Bootstrap is a robust tool that permits you to quickly build attractive web sites that look great on desktops, telephones, and tablets. Whereas there are some particular disadvantages to Bootstrap, in many cases, the benefits of website responsiveness, extensive compatibility, and saved time will outweigh the cons. You can even eliminate the largest drawbacks with a bit of extra effort and time. It’s potential to use Bootstrap’s customization instruments to remove code and functions that you simply don’t need, however it will take a while and Bootstrap expertise.

Bootstrap is a perfect option for beginner builders because it allows individuals to pick out the exact elements they wish to embody in a project they usually don’t want to put in writing the code from scratch. What Bootstrap does in one other way compared to different frameworks is that it uses jQuery extensively. Without jQuery, cross-browser compatibility wouldn’t be attainable, and JavaScript would be overly difficult. The Bootstrap package deal incorporates all of the tools that a developer would wish to construct a daily consumer interface following the newest tendencies and necessities in terms of responsivity and flexibility. If you’re uninterested in writing dozens of long code strings, together with CSS, Bootstrap will assist you to by simplifying the process tremendously.

Bootstrap is presently on its fifth model, and it’s grown lots throughout its evolution. This means that you’re working with familiar tools that provide a strong basis for building dynamic and visually appealing web sites. Whether Or Not you are aligning textual content, pictures, or interactive elements, the grid mechanics of Bootstrap make the method intuitive and efficient https://deveducation.com/.

what does bootstrap do

It Can Be Built-in Easily

what does bootstrap do

It’s akin to tapping instantly into a primary water line – swift and environment friendly. You can make the most of a pre-made theme or make your own by altering the Bootstrap files to satisfy the construction and specs of your CMS to combine Bootstrap into a CMS. The broadly used CMSs Joomla, Drupal, and WordPress all help Bootstrap. This framework has been updated a quantity of occasions what is bootstrap, with major variations between variations four and 5.

If you want easy recruiting from a worldwide pool of expert candidates, we’re right here to assist. Our graduates are highly expert, motivated, and ready for impactful careers in tech. Our career-change applications are designed to take you from newbie to pro in your tech career—with customized support each step of the way. Integrating Bootstrap within these environments involves leveraging its CDN or npm packages to mesh seamlessly with the component-driven structure of these frameworks.

How Do You Use Bootstrap In Your Web Improvement Project?

  • These recordsdata contain Bootstrap’s major JavaScript libraries for things like carousels, drop-down menus, search auto suggest and tons of different highly effective JavaScript functionalities.
  • No extra spending hours coding your own grid—Bootstrap comes with its personal grid system predefined.
  • Bootstrap.css is a CSS framework that arranges and manages the structure of an internet site.
  • For instance, most WordPress themes had been developed using Bootstrap, which any newbie internet developer can entry.
  • To facilitate mobile-first design, Bootstrap simplifies the process of making responsive layouts and dealing with typography, varieties, navigation, and other widespread net components.

Initially created at Twitter by Mark Otto and Jacob Thornton in 2011, Bootstrap has developed into some of the popular frameworks within the web improvement community. Its open-source nature implies that anyone can use, modify, and contribute to its ongoing improvement. Now that you’ve learned in regards to the basics of Bootstrap, it’s time to take a deep dive to leverage its full potential. Before you discover methods to use Bootstrap you first must be taught HTML, CSS, and JavaScript, all expertise we teach as part of our Entrance End Developer monitor in our Break Into Tech program.

These are great places for web developers and internet designers to share data and focus on the latest variations of Bootstrap patches. Some of the most well-liked bundle managers include npm, Composer, and Bower. Npm manages server-side dependencies, whereas Composer focuses on the front-end. For improved cross-browser rendering, we use Reboot to correct inconsistencies across browsers and devices while offering slightly extra opinionated resets to common HTML components.

Responsive And Adaptive

Bootstrap has lengthy been used as an industry commonplace tool to easily develop web sites that adapt to multiple screen sizes, together with cellphones. Utilizing it pre-made parts and types which will easily be modified by developers, Bootstrap simplifies creating user-friendly internet interfaces. If you need to learn Bootstrap however aren’t yet an skilled in website improvement, we’ve obtained some good news. Bootstrap is designed to be easy to use—all you want is a primary understanding of internet layouts and entrance finish coding languages like HTML and CSS.

In programming, a “bootstrap” to one thing that launches one other system, normally an working system. In the true world, a “bootstrap” is the little piece at the again of a boot that permits you to pull it on. All Through software improvement, it refers to a smaller system that boots up a much bigger system. The many benefits help describe why Bootstrap has such a hold on front-end growth. First designed for inner use at Twitter, Bootstrap took off quickly. As a beginner developer or programmer, deciding which programming language to learn first can be powerful.

The studying curve may be steeper for newcomers to internet growth. Whether you’re embarking on your web improvement journey or looking for effectivity as an experienced coder, Bootstrap has a lot to supply. As a developer, you possibly can rest assured that your website will look nice throughout various units without having to manually tinker with code.

While Bootstrap is designed to be simple to make use of, you might face some challenges. For instance, if you need to customise the design, you would possibly need to override the default Bootstrap styles, which may be tough if you’re not familiar with CSS. Also, as a end result of Bootstrap includes lots of components, it may be quite large, which could affect the performance of your web site. The image added has class img-fluid that makes it fit to the dimensions of the mother or father div irrespective of its personal size.